Abandoned Wind Turbine Factory
< on 12/21/2020 5:03 AM >
Reply with Quote
Posted on Forum: UER Forum



In the early 2010s, a Chinese firm announced that it was investing $25 million and creating 250 jobs in
southern Ontario with the opening of this new wind turbine manufacturing facility.

The chief executive officer of the overseas firm announced, "We are thrilled to be bringing this level of
investment to the city and region." After four days of intense negotiations, the local mayor stated in a
media release, "The future is looking bright!" The local member of provincial government exclaimed,
"We are getting out of dirty coal. Clean energy is the way to go. It is the future."

After only 3 years of operation, the entire 210-acre site was completely abandoned
and has been in this state ever since.

Sadly, in 2013, a worker was standing on the tracks in the photo below,
positioned between two massive wind tower segments that were resting on adjustable welding rotators.
The worker was collecting tools from the work area when one of the tower segments began to
silently move along the tracks. He was unaware of its approach until it was within 10 centimetres,
and the worker was unable to escape. He desperately called out for someone to stop the segment's
movement with a remote control, but by time his co-workers responded, he had
already been crushed between two tower segments.

The worker had been employed at the plant for about three weeks.
The company was fined $80,000.

Perhaps the most shocking aspects of this location was the sheer abandonment of assets.
When the overseas company pulled out of North America, it was very sudden and it seems as
though no attempt was made to sell anything. I did not include photos of the
business office area in this gallery, but even personal items like coffee mugs,
expensive sunglasses and family photos still sit on the desks of senior management.
I find I am sometimes quite liberal with the term "abandoned" in this hobby, but this
is a location that quite literally was completely and utterly abandoned.
